Torreys on track for strong finish
Local scholastic track teams are putting their best feet forward as the post-season winds down.
La Jolla Country Day School and head coach Kevin Reaume head into the CIF Finals at Mt. Carmel High this week on a high. The boys finished the season at 8-0 and the girls were 6-1.
Coastal League winners were: Valerie Christy (800m); Lauren Pischel (3200m); Anna Blumenfeld (discus); Alex Maire (100m, 200m); Lance Rutledge (400m); Rutledge, Rali Schwartz, Josh Acheatel, Alex Maire (4 x 100 relay) and Taylor Sarkaria (pole vault).
Athletes advancing to CIF Finals this Saturday are: Anna Blumenfeld, A flight discus (top three in A flights or A heats advance to State), B flight shot put; Jacquelyn Vanderlip, B heat, 100H; Valerie Christy, B heat, 800m; Lauren Pischel, B heat, 3200m; and Rutledge, Schwartz, Acheatel and Maire, B heat, 4×100 relay.
School records set this season included: Maire ” 100m, 10.7 (broke Rashaan Salaam’s mark 10.8, Tied Salaam’s 200m 22.8); Taylor Sarkaria and Jon Volfson ” pole vault, 11-6; Patricia Decker ” pole vault, 8-10; and Shani Davis ” 200m, 26.88 (broke Candice Wiggins’ mark of 27.0).
“The men and women of this team dedicated themselves into making this a successful season,” Reaume said. “Over the past six years, going to a track once a week, our women’s team has won five conference titles (41 out of 42 dual meets) and the men’s team has won three conference titles (44 out of 48 dual meets).”
Acura Tennis tix now on sale
Individual tickets for the 2006 Acura Classic, to be held July 29 through Aug. 6 at the La Costa Resort & Spa, are now on sale.
The tournament also announced that advance sales of ticket packages are up by 8 percent over last year’s tournament sales. In addition, to give fans more options, the tournament has begun offering several new packages, including a Weekend Box Package and Weekday Tented Skybox Packages.
According to tournament owner Jane Stratton, box seats are selling particularly well. While the VIP Terrace section is already sold out, there is still availability in the Gold and Classic Box Seat sections around the court.
Tuesday, Aug. 1 has been designated as Group Day at the Acura Classic. Fans attending either the Day Session or Night Session in groups of 10 or more will receive a 50 percent discount on reserved grandstand seating.
